Lots of good points in your email to Juergen. We already have some things in place that I think apply to concerns you've raised, the one below in particular. Our Operating Guidelines for Personal Submersibles ( http://www.psubs.org/guidelines/PSUBS ) has Chapter 2, Section 2 (1), deals with communications. We require at least one marine band radio for surface communications. One of the nice things about the PSUBS guidelines is that we have set up a process where the community can submit proposals for additions, changes, and deletions. When we receive proposals, we draft them into an RFC (Request For Comment) and publish them. Then the rest of the community is provided an opportunity to comment on the proposal for a period of 30-45 days, after which a decision is made on the proposal. On the webpage link provided above, you'll find links to proposals and adoptions that we've made. I encourage anyone who has an idea that will promote both safety and self-regulation to take advantage of this system, since if nothing else it does show potential regulators that we are at least attempting to be responsible.
